如何设置Google的v8 JavaScript独立引擎以进行远程调试?

6

我该如何设置/构建/运行谷歌的V8引擎,以便可以调用示例javascript文件,并逐步解释所有内容直到C++代码呢?


+1 表示感谢你提出问题。 :-) - rajakvk
1
虽然我很希望自己能得到这个问题的答案,但我想分享一下我在这里找到了与JSON相关的调试参考资料:https://code.google.com/p/v8-wiki/wiki/DebuggerProtocol;我知道可以将调试器连接到V8引擎中的一个端口,因此我猜测这就是使用的协议。顺便说一句:它确实提到了使用基于函数的API进行进程内调试。不过,在维基百科上搜索并没有产生任何结果。: / - James Wilkins
1个回答

0
更新:这是以前的做法。
V8 维基页面 提供了示例“lineprocessor.cc”程序,可运行定制的 JavaScript 代码,并说明如何为这些脚本启用调试。

3
不,它并没有。例如,维基提到了一些东西,比如设置调试消息处理程序和其他几件事,而示例似乎没有使用维基中提到的任何机制,这使读者不得不盲目猜测如何实际连接这些东西。 - markt1964

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接